Market Overview:
The global hydrogel-based drug delivery system market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 10.8% during the forecast period from 2018 to 2030. The growth in this market can be attributed to the increasing demand for novel and advanced drug delivery systems, rising prevalence of chronic diseases, and growing focus on R&D activities by pharmaceutical companies. Based on type, the global hydrogel-based drug delivery system market can be segmented into natural system and synthesis system. The natural system segment is expected to account for a larger share of the market in 2018 owing to its advantages such as biocompatibility, non-toxicity, and easy scalability. By application, the subcutaneous application segment is expected to account for a larger share of the global hydrogel-based drug delivery system market in 2018 due to its growing use in various therapeutic areas such as diabetes mellitus and rheumatoid arthritis.
Product Definition:
A hydrogel-based drug delivery system is a type of drug delivery system that uses hydrogels as the carrier for the drug. Hydrogels are water-containing polymers that can absorb large amounts of water, making them excellent carriers for drugs. Their high water content also makes them good at delivering moisture to the skin, which can be beneficial in treating conditions like dry skin or eczema. Additionally, hydrogel-based systems are often nonirritating and nonallergenic, making them ideal for use on sensitive skin.

Application Insights:
Based on application, the global hydrogel-based drug delivery system market is segmented into subcutaneous, ocular, oral cavity, topical and other. The subcutaneous region dominated the overall market in terms of revenue in 2017 owing to increasing usage of these products for delivering drugs at the desired site of action. This method is most commonly used for local injections around muscles and joints which are widely accepted across various patient groups.
The oral cavity region is expected to witness significant growth over the forecast period due to increasing usage as a drug delivery device for dental procedures such as tooth extraction or filling.
Regional Analysis:
North America dominated the global market in 2017. The region is expected to maintain its position during the forecast period owing to increasing R&D investments by various companies and rising healthcare expenditure. In addition, high prevalence of chronic diseases such as diabetes and cancer is also anticipated to drive regional growth over the forecast period.
Asia Pacific is estimated to be fastest-growing region during the same period due to factors such as growing economy, improving healthcare infrastructure, increase in disposable income & consumer awareness about early diagnosis of chronic diseases coupled with rising demand for cost-effective treatment options for patients across this region.
